I've been swinging 28oz end loaded Ambush bats for the last two years and they have given me the best compromise between performance and durability. I get about 250 cuts out of the Ambush before it cracks but it performs very well for me. It might seem like 250 swings out of bat is terrible but it is a senior bat and I can live with that.

I am in now way associated with Combat or even know Alan Tanner, I am just stating my experience with the Combat Ambush. I am sure the bat is not for everybody but as far as I'm concerned it's a pretty hot bat with decent (I use the term loosely becasue it's a senior bat) durability.
